    Casey Sanders (born October 23, 1979) is a retired American professional basketball player better known for his high school and collegiate careers in the United States. He was the starting center in the 2001 NCAA tournament national championship game for Duke , who won the game and were crowned national champions during his sophomore season.

    Dwane Lyndon Casey (born April 17, 1957) is an American basketball coach who most recently served as the head coach of the Detroit Pistons before transitioning to a front office position with the team. [1] He is a former NCAA basketball player and coach, having played and coached there for over a decade before moving on to the NBA. [2]

    Casey Gardner Jacobsen (born March 19, 1981) is an American retired professional basketball player who played four seasons in the National Basketball Association (NBA). He also had an extensive European basketball career, mostly while playing with Brose Baskets Bamberg , in Germany.

    Doug Collins was the head coach for the Pistons from 1995 to 1998. Larry Brown was the Detroit Pistons head coach from 2003 to 2005 and led the team to the NBA championship in 2004. Flip Saunders was the coach for the Pistons from 2005 to 2008. Lawrence Frank was the coach for the Pistons from 2011 to 2013.

Kyle David Casey (born November 27, 1990) is an American professional basketball player who last played for the Abejas de León of the Mexican LNBP. He played college basketball for Harvard .

    Fairfield has removed the interim tag from men's basketball coach Chris Casey's title, the school announced Tuesday. Casey was named the Stags interim coach in October after Jay Young resigned.
